On Sun, Jan 31, 2021 at 11:12:14AM +0000, Russell King - ARM Linux admin wrote:
> I discussed it with Andrew earlier last year, and his response was:
> 
>  DT configuration of pause for fixed link probably is sufficient. I don't
>  remember it ever been really discussed for DSA. It was a Melanox
>  discussion about limiting pause for the CPU. So I think it is safe to
>  not implement ethtool -A, at least until somebody has a real use case
>  for it.
> 
> So I chose not to support it - no point supporting features that people
> aren't using. If you have a "real use case" then it can be added.

This patch may be sufficient - I haven't fully considered all the
implications of changing this though.

 drivers/net/phy/phylink.c | 9 +++------
 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/net/phy/phylink.c b/drivers/net/phy/phylink.c
index 7e0fdc17c8ee..2ee0d4dcf9a5 100644
--- a/drivers/net/phy/phylink.c
+++ b/drivers/net/phy/phylink.c
@@ -673,7 +673,6 @@ static void phylink_resolve(struct work_struct *w)
 		switch (pl->cur_link_an_mode) {
 		case MLO_AN_PHY:
 			link_state = pl->phy_state;
-			phylink_apply_manual_flow(pl, &link_state);
 			mac_config = link_state.link;
 			break;
 
@@ -698,11 +697,12 @@ static void phylink_resolve(struct work_struct *w)
 				link_state.pause = pl->phy_state.pause;
 				mac_config = true;
 			}
-			phylink_apply_manual_flow(pl, &link_state);
 			break;
 		}
 	}
 
+	phylink_apply_manual_flow(pl, &link_state);
+
 	if (mac_config) {
 		if (link_state.interface != pl->link_config.interface) {
 			/* The interface has changed, force the link down and
@@ -1639,9 +1639,6 @@ int phylink_ethtool_set_pauseparam(struct phylink *pl,
 
 	ASSERT_RTNL();
 
-	if (pl->cur_link_an_mode == MLO_AN_FIXED)
-		return -EOPNOTSUPP;
-
 	if (!phylink_test(pl->supported, Pause) &&
 	    !phylink_test(pl->supported, Asym_Pause))
 		return -EOPNOTSUPP;
@@ -1684,7 +1681,7 @@ int phylink_ethtool_set_pauseparam(struct phylink *pl,
 	/* Update our in-band advertisement, triggering a renegotiation if
 	 * the advertisement changed.
 	 */
-	if (!pl->phydev)
+	if (!pl->phydev && pl->cur_link_an_mode != MLO_AN_FIXED)
 		phylink_change_inband_advert(pl);
 
 	mutex_unlock(&pl->state_mutex);
